Work measurement system for forklift operations
Toshimasa Aso (Tokyo Univ. of Marine Science and Technology) LOIS2021-9

(in English) This paper describes inclusive work measurement system for forklift operations, work element estimation scheme, and its performance evaluation. This system has two functions. These are a work estimation function and a forklift risk assessment function. We discuss a work element estimation method that classifies forklift operator’s work into three work elements such as driving, walking, and manual handling. The work elements are calculated by sensors data of a smartphone in the breast pocket. This method uses qualitative features of the work elements. Peaks of resultant acceleration are utilized for reducing cost of parameter tuning. Experiment carried out in the logistics center. Its performance is evaluated. The results show that average error rate is less than 3%. Therefore, it is shown that this method is useful for operations improvement.
